Notes

Brother-in-law of 1846 Private Richard James Gleeson (DOD).

 

John Daly landed in France in May 1917. In September he was hospitalised in France with a fever then admitted to Cheltenham Red Cross Hospital. In October 1918 he transferred to the 15th Battalion. He returned to Australia in December and was discharged in April 1919.
